Steinways are some of the few handmade pianos still made today. At Lindeblad, we sing Steinway praises, because our team appreciates the level of detail and expertise required to build a piano of their caliber.
This level of craftsmanship is going to increase in value upon restoration and will add another lifetime of use. So, one of the first steps in determining the return on your restoration investment is going to be knowing the age of your Steinway.
This will tell us as restoration experts the exact stylist elements and detailed construction choices that were employed at the time of production. This is also going to help us anticipate the condition of certain parts like the hammers, strings, action, and others.
Knowing the age of your Steinway will help our team at Lindeblad begin to put together a game plan for restoration, by defining the scope of the project and which elements of the piano ought to be replaced or refinished. Other people bring transactional purchase date papers, and we can do our best to estimate.
It is only until we can see the piano serial number that we can give an exact age, and finding the serial number is something you can do from home! When buying a Steinway piano, we recommend sitting at the instrument and exploring its character by focusing on the bass and the lyrical possibilities. A big robust bass and nuanced tone in the treble are hallmarks of a classic Steinway sound. In terms of Steinway piano care, we go by the motto "less is more. In general, to clean and maintain your Steinway piano simply use a soft, lightly dampened cheese cloth and rub gently in the same direction as the grain texture do not dig in!
